I hated the words Alcoholic, Alcohol Dependent, Drunk, P1sshead, and I don't exactly wear a badge with 'Alcoholic and Proud' on it.
However, I needed to admit to myself that I am an alcoholic to recover. If I don't admit it to myself, then I am always going to live in hope that one day I will be able to control my drinking.
For me, I will never become a social drinker. I believe I was born alcoholic, and there is no moderation for me. There never was.
Thus I need to manage my condition as best as possible, and not wish for something that isn't going to happen.
If I could choose, I would choose to be a social drinker. But I don't have that choice. And it is what it is. So I best get on with it, and live my life in the real world (where I am an alcoholic). I used to be full of dreams and fantases, and all of them were getting further away because of my drinking.
